This study synthetically makes use of multi-research methods, such as the computer numerical simulation, the analysis of cross and regression, the observation of mine pressure at the spot to study systematic the wall rock stress and roof-off-strata of the gate main coal seam bolting support in Xin-ji No.2 Colliery. By cross experiment, we get the optimum supporting parameter. According to analysis the result of cross experiment, we gain the regression related equation and established the theory foundation of the support design. By computer simulation, we analysis and study the law of wall rock stress distribution, deformation ,the axial force of bolt and the roof-off-strata. The observation of mine pressure at the spot indicated that the roof rock seam didn't appear the phenomenon the roof-off-the strata and it would go to steady some time inside and outside the anchorage.
